On the trivializability of rank-one cocycles with an invariant field of projective measures

  • Alessio Savini

摘要

Let G be \(SO ^\circ (n,1)\) S O ( n , 1 ) for \(n \geqslant 3\) n 3 and consider a lattice \(\Gamma < G\) Γ < G . Given a standard Borel probability \(\Gamma \) Γ -space \((\Omega ,\mu )\) ( Ω , μ ) , consider a measurable cocycle \(\sigma :\Gamma \hspace{1.111pt}{\times }\hspace{1.111pt}\Omega \rightarrow {\textbf{H}}(\kappa )\) σ : Γ × Ω H ( κ ) , where \({\textbf{H}}\) H is a connected algebraic \(\kappa \) κ -group over a local field \(\kappa \) κ . Under the assumption of compatibility between G and the pair \(({\textbf{H}},\kappa )\) ( H , κ ) , we show that if \(\sigma \) σ admits an equivariant field of probability measures on a suitable projective space, then \(\sigma \) σ is trivializable. An analogous result holds in the complex hyperbolic case.
